#942c09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#942c09 is composed of 58% red, 17.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.3%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 15.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 30.8%. #942c09 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5812 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#942c09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#942c09 has RGB values of R:148, G:44,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.94,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9710601.

Shades and Tints of #942c09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fef1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#942c09
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524d4b is the less saturated color, while #9a2903 is the most saturated one.
